.. Generated automatically by cpp2rst .. highlight:: c .. role:: red .. role:: green .. role:: param .. _triqs__hilbert_space__stateLTHilbertSpace_ScalarType_falseGT: triqs::hilbert_space::state ========================================================== *#include * .. rst-class:: cppsynopsis template class :red:`state` State: implementation based on `nda::vector` Member types ------------ .. table:: :widths: 40 60 +-----------------+--------------+------------------------------------------------+ | value_type | ScalarType | Accessor to `ScalarType` template parameter | +-----------------+--------------+------------------------------------------------+ | hilbert_space_t | HilbertSpace | Accessor to `HilbertSpace` template parameter | +-----------------+--------------+------------------------------------------------+ Member functions ---------------- .. table:: :widths: 40 60 +--------------------------------------------------------------------------------------------------+--+ | :ref:`(constructor) 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`size 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`operator() 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`operator+= 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`operator-= 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`operator*= 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`operator/= 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`amplitudes 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`get_hilbert ` | | +--------------------------------------------------------------------------------------------------+--+ | :ref:`set_hilbert ` | | +--------------------------------------------------------------------------------------------------+--+ .. toctree:: :hidden: stateLTHilbertSpace,ScalarType,falseGT/constructor stateLTHilbertSpace,ScalarType,falseGT/size stateLTHilbertSpace,ScalarType,falseGT/operator() stateLTHilbertSpace,ScalarType,falseGT/operator+= stateLTHilbertSpace,ScalarType,falseGT/operator-= stateLTHilbertSpace,ScalarType,falseGT/operator*= stateLTHilbertSpace,ScalarType,falseGT/operator/= stateLTHilbertSpace,ScalarType,falseGT/amplitudes stateLTHilbertSpace,ScalarType,falseGT/get_hilbert stateLTHilbertSpace,ScalarType,falseGT/set_hilbert Non Member functions -------------------- .. table:: :widths: 40 60 +------------------------------------------------------------------------------------------------+--+ | :ref:`dot_product ` | | +------------------------------------------------------------------------------------------------+--+ | :ref:`foreach ` | | +------------------------------------------------------------------------------------------------+--+ .. toctree:: :hidden: stateLTHilbertSpace,ScalarType,falseGT/dot_product stateLTHilbertSpace,ScalarType,falseGT/foreach